Changing plug on charger?
I have the pictured charger that is for an EZGO 36v cart, can I buy a crows foot plug put it on this charger and use it for a 36v club car? or am I not going to get that lucky?

Re: Changing plug on charger?
Don't see why it wouldn't. At 36v there isn't a OBC involved.

Re: Changing plug on charger?
Yes it will work fine. Just make sure you put the positive and negative wires in the right spot.

Re: Changing plug on charger?
Might want to check the size of the crows foot you are putting on the charger side.
The last one I did like this the housing was too big to fit in the CC cart side receptacle. Had to remove the cart side trim ring to make it work. |
